Who, when, where, and how much for pizza.
Connecticut River Sunday Oct 18th. Most boats larger then 25 feet launch in Old Saybrook in the mid-late morning and run up to a beach in Rocky Hill. Money for pizza is to cover costs and to donate to a charity. I paid 20 bucks for 3 slices last year
